Project Gemini Information🔥
Disclaimer: This book is still being written so any information here is subject to change
Title: Deviant
Series: The Zodiacs Book 1
Genre: YA Dystopian
Tags: Enemies to Lovers, found family, dystopian, queer romance, hell queer people in general, slow burn romance
I’m hella new to the idea of tagging my story so apologies if I don’t really know what to tag my story with/I do it wrong
If you liked… you might like this: The Lunar Chronicles, Arc of a Scythe, Uglies, The House of the Scorpion, The Red Queen Series
Trigger warnings: This story deals with an oppressive government which includes things like police brutality, gaslighting, mental and physical abuse, and general violence as well as PTSD
Would rate PG-13 ish? Uncertain.
Synopsis:
Deviants are born different.
Caspian is a deviant. More than anything he wants to be a doctor. But the laws against deviants prevent him from being able to take on medical training beyond being a nurse.
Adrian is a deviant. He has spent his entire life struggling under the weight of government expectations and military power. He has spent the last five years conspiring with others to put an end to deviant oppression.
When an accident at the hospital gets Caspian arrested, he is thrown headfirst into Adrian’s revolution and discovers who he really is.

(dis)Continuity in fiction...
I’m working on my revision of “The Dragon Lord” for Venture Press.
Mostly it’s the usual tightening of dialogue from prepared speeches to realistic conversation, the removal of ellipses and en-dashes which younger Morwood used by the unnecessary bushel - and in this book, some heavy rewriting to remove Tuckerisations of character and quote that not merely break the Fourth Wall but shatter it.
I’d included Anne McCaffrey as a fairly identifiable character (she had just introduced me to @dduane, with all that followed after. There were quotes, all used with permission, I still have the letters, from “Dragonflight”, “Stormbringer”, “Bridge of Birds” and “Conan the Conqueror”. All of this seemed like a good idea at the time – they make sense in context, and certainly nobody objected either then or since – but older Morwood thinks they have no place in a much more rounded secondary world, so out they go.
(This is a bit like using German and Italian HEMA terminology in fantasy: the moves may be authentic, but if there isn’t a Germany or Italy in that fantasy world it’s best to think up other names for the moves.)
I’m also correcting continuity errors that have been in print for 30+ years (yes, really – unnoticed by me, my agent, and at last count two English-language editors and four foreign-language ones…)
Mostly it’s objects and people in two places at the same time, or at least within a few paragraphs of each other and no linking action to indicate how they got there, but today I’ve reached the bit in “Dragon Lord” where Gemmel the wizard Summons an icedrake near the end of a chapter, uses it to defeat his enemies and makes his escape.
End of chapter. Next chapter is at a later time in a completely different location.
There were a couple of paragraphs describing how Gemmel did the Summoning of the icedrake, but there isn’t a single line describing how he Dismissed it. I’ve just done a Search through the entire book and Gemmel never Dismissed it.
That icedrake, like a supernatural stove, tap or faucet, has been “left running” in six languages since 1986…
So if any test readers take you to task for significantly opening a door and forgetting to shut it, look on the bright side: that’s an error which has been caught. And rest assured that professionals have done something similar. They still do…
